Устройство для цифровой обработки аналогового сигнала

Номер патента: 1566370

Автор: Файнзильберг

Скачать ZIP архив.

Текст

(191 (31 У ОПИСАН А ВТОРСКОМ ИЗОБ ЛЬСТ тво СССР 2, 1971, о СССР /46, 1986 1981 с 8 ОСУДАРСТВЕННЫЙ КОМИТЕТП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МПРИ ГКНТ СССР 3266/24-2407.8805.90, Бюл. М 19титут кибернетикГлушкова(54) УСТРОЙСТВО ДЛЯ ЦИФРОВОЙ ОБРАБОТКИ АНАЛОГОВОГО СИГНАЛА(57) Изобретение относится к цифровойвычислительной технике, Цель - расширение функциональных возможностейустройства за счет определения в цифровой форме наибольшего и наименьшего значений аналогового сигнала.Устройство содержит схему 1 сравнения, генератор 2 импульсов, счетчики35, дешифраторы 6, 7, цифроаналоговый преобразователь 8, регистры 9,10, элементы И 1116, элементыНЕ 17, 18. 2 ил.Изобретение относится к цифровойвычислительной технике и может бытьиспользовано при решении задач медицинской и технической диагностики,Цель изобретения - расширение5функциональных возможностей устройства за счет определения в цифровойформе наибольшего и наименьшего значений аналогового сигнала.На Фиг.1 представлена схема устройства для цифровой обработки аналогового сигнала; на фиг.2 - временнаядиаграмма, поясняющая принцип егодействия,15Устройство для цифровой обработкианалогового сигнала содержит (Фиг,1)схему 1 сравнения, генератор 2 импульсов, первый 3, второй 4 и третий5 реверсивные счетчики первый О ивторой 7 дешифраторы нуля, цифроаналоговый преобразователь 8, первый 9и второй 10 регистры, с первого пошестой элементы И 11-16 первый 17и второй 18 элементы НЕ,25Устройство работает следующим образом.Обрабатываемый аналоговый сигналХ(Г.) поступает на первый вход схемысравнения. На второй вход этой схемы поступает компенсирующий аналого 31вый сигнал Хобратной связи свыхода цифроаналогового преобразователя 8. Если сигна.л Х больше сигнала Х (1) (режим "Недокомпенсация"),то на первом выходе схемы 1 сравнения образуется сигнал логической единицы, который открывает элемент И 11,иптульсы от генератора. 2 через элемент И 11 поступают на вход сложенияреверсивного счетчика 5, Содержимое 40этого счетчика увеличивается, чтов свою очередь вызывает увеличениеомпенсирующег о аналогового сигналакна выходе цифроаналоговогопреобразователя 8, Как только сигнал 45Хстановится равным сигналу Хс точностью до Р,( Е, - порог нечувствительности), схема 1 сравнениязакрывает элемент И 11,Если обрабатываемый сигнал Х 50меньше компенсирующего сигнала Х (С)(режим "11 ерекомпенсация"), то на втором выходе схемы 1 сравнения образуется сигнал логической единицы, который открывает элемент И 12, и импульсы от генератора 2 поступают ужена вход вычитания реверсивного счетчика 5. Содержимое этого счетчика уменьшается, что вызывает уменьшениекомпенсирующего сигнала Х,(1). Кактолько сигнал Хстановится равным сигналу Х(Г.) с точностью досхема 1 сравнения закрывает элементИ 12. Тем самым осуществляется следящее преобразование обрабатываемогосигнала Х(С) в цифровую форму, в процессе которого на выходах разрядовреверсивного счетчика 5 образуетсяпараллельный код, пропорциональныйтекущему значению сигнала Х, ана выходе элементов И 11 и 12 образуется реверсивный число-импульсныйкод, представляющий собой последовательность кодовых импульсов К и К;образуемых соответственно лри каждомэлементарном положительном и отрицательном приращениях сигнала,Кодовые импульсы К , образуемыена выходе элемента И 11, поступаютна вход сложения реверсивного счетчика 3 и через элемент И 13 на входвычитания реверсивного счетчика 4,Кодовые импульсы К , образуемые навыходе элемента И 12, поступают навход сложения реверсивного счетчикаи через элемент И 15 на вход вычитания реверсивного счетчика 3, Спомощью дешифраторов б и 7 осуществляется блокировка счета на вычитание в счетчиках 3 и 4, как только всоответствующем счетчике образуетсячисло нуль, Блокировка достигаетсятем, что при появлении в счетчике 3числа нуль на. выходе дешифратора 6,подключенного к нулевым выходам разрядов счетчика 3, образуется погенциал логической единицы, который через элемент НЕ 17 (инвертор) блокирует элемент И 15, Аналогичным об-,азом с помощь дешифратсра 7 и: а входа вычитанн счетчика 4,В начале цикла ооработки сиги,.лаХ(Г) в момент времени (фиг,2)помощью, например, кнопки начальнойустановки (не показана) на дополнительные управляющие входы регистров9 и 10, а также на входы начальнойустановки счетчиков 3 и 4 подаетсяуправляющий сигнал, посредством которого в регистры 9 и 10 по шинам параллельной передачи данных из реверсивного счетчика 5 заносится кодвеличины Х, представляющий собойзначение сигнала Х в момент времени , счетчики 3 и 4 обнуляются,5 15В результате ца выходах дешифраторов 6 и 7 образуются потенциалы логической единицы, которые открывают элементы И 16 и 14 и через элементы НЕ 17 и 18 блокируют входывычитания счетчиков 3 и 4В интервале времени между моментами 1 иоС (Аиг,2) сигнал Х(г.) возрастает,а значит, образуются кодовые импульсы К на выходе элемента И 11, Этиимпульсы поступают на вход сложенияреверсивного счетчика 3 и вход элемента И 13, который в данной ситуации заблокирован сигналом от дешифратора 7 нуля, В результате в указанный промежуток времени счетчик4 продолжает оставаться в нулевомсостоянии, а счетчик 3 работает насложение, причем содержимое этогосчетчика пропорционально текущемуположительному приращению сигналаХ(С) относительно его значения Хв момент времени СОдновременно каждый кодовый импульс К+ с выхода элемента И 11через элемент И 14, открытый сигналом логической единицы на выходедешиАратора 7 нуля, проходит науправляющий вход регистра 9В реЪгистр 9 по шинам параллельной передачи данных из реверсивного счетчика 5 последовательно заносятсякоды дискретных значений сигналаХ(Г) на указанном интервале времени, Следовательно, в момент времени в регистре 9 занесен код величины Х , представляющий собой наибольшее значение сигнала от моментаначала цикла обработки,В момент времени Т, (Аиг,2) происходит изменение знака приращениясигнала, а значит, на выходе элемента И 12 начинают образовыватьсякодовые импульсы К . Эти импульсыпоступают на вход сложения реверсивного счетчика 4 и на вход элемента И 15, Поскольку в реверсивномсчетчике 3 в данной ситуации содержится число, отличное от нуля, тона выходе дешиАратора 6 образуетсясигнал логического нуля, которыйблокирует элемент И 16 и через элемент НЕ 17 открывает элемент И 15.Поэтому в интервале межцу моментамивремени , и С кодовые импульсыК свободно проходят на вход вычитания счетчика 3, уменьшая содержимоепоследнего. Однако к моменту време 66370 6ци С содержимое этого счетчика ещеце достигнет нуля, поскольку значение сигнала Хбольше значения сигнала Х, Содержимое реверсивногосчетчика 4 увеличивается и к моментувремени С ., оказывается пропорциональным отрицательному приращению сигнала Х(г.) относительно значения Х 1наибольшего локального значения об 10рабатываемого сигнала от моментаначала цикла его обработки,В момент времени С (Аиг,2) происходит очередное изменение знака приращения сигнала Х(С) и снова образо 15вываются уже кодовые импульсы К+Эти импульсы поступают на вход сложения реверсивного счетчика 3 и открытый дешифратором 7 вход вычитанияреверсивного счетчика 4, Содержимоесчетчика 3 постоянно увеличивается,а счетчика 4 - уменьшается до техпор, пока в момент времени(Аиг,2), когда Х = Х содержимоесчетчика 4 окажется равным нулю, Вэтот момент времени С дешифратор7 блокирует элемент И 13, предотвращая дальнейший счет на вычитаниесчетчиком 4, и открывает элемент И 14,В результате, начиная с момента времени з, в регистр 9 снова записывается ицАормация из реверсивного счетчика 5, а значит к моменту временив регистре 9 содержится код величины Х, представляющей собой но 35 вое наибольшее значение обрабатываемого сигнала от момента Т, началацикла его обработки (Х) Х ),Начиная с момента времени(Аиг,2), сигнал Х(С) уменьшается, азначит, образуются кодовые импульсыК , которые поступают ца вход сложения счетчика 4 и вход вычитаниясчетчика 3. При этом содержимоесчетчика 4 в каждьй момент времени45 пропорционально текущему приращениюсигнала Х(С) относительно наибольшеголокального значения Х в течениецикла обработки сигнала, а содержимое счетчика 3 пропорционально текущему положительному приращению сигнала Х(г.) относительно наименьшего локального значения Х в течение цикола обработки сигнала.В моменты времении С (Аиг,2)55 происходят очередцыс изменения знака приращения сигнала Х(1), что вызывает изменения направления счетав счетчиках 3 и 4, Однако поскольку25 экстремальные сигналы Х и Х не являются ни наибольшими, ни наименьшими значениями сигнала, то ни в счетчике 3, ни в счетчике 4 числа нуль не образуется, а значит, не происходит срабатывание дешифраторов 6 и 7, Поэтому элементы И 14 и 16 остаются закрытыми и, следовательно, запись новой информации в регистры 9 и 10 не осуществляется.В момент времени 1, когда значение сигнала Х становйтся равным наи 7меньшему значению Хо, принятому в момент временисодержимое счетчика 3 становится равным нулю. При этом срабатывает дешифратор 6, закрывается элемент И 15 и открывается элемент И 16, В результате, начиная с момента времени С, счет на вычитание счетчика 3 прекращается и в нем сохраняется число нуль. Одновременно каждый кодовый импульс К осуществляет запись в регистр 10 информации из реверсивного счетчика 5, Таким образом, к моменту времени С в регистре 10 содержится код значения сигнала Х, представляющий собой новое наименьшее значение сигнала от момента времени , начала цикла его обработки.В интервале между моментами времени Г иэ (фиг,2) счетчик 3 работает на сложение, а счетчик 4 - на вычитание, причем содержимое счетчика 3 пропорционально локальному по 35 ложительному приращению сигнала Х(С) относительно наименьшего значения Х8 от момента Со начала обработки, а содержимое счетчика 4 пропорциональ 40 но отрицательному локальному приращению сигнала Х относительно наибольшего значения Х от моментаначала обработки. Ввиду того, чтоуказанные приращения отличны от нуля, 45то в течение рассматриваемого интервала времени депифраторы 6 и 7 несрабатывают, а значит, запись новой информации в регистры 9 и 10 неосуществляется.В момент времени(фиг.2) происходит очередное изменение знака приращения сигнала и счетчик 3 начинает работать на вычитание, асчетчик 4 - на сложение, В моментвремени Сц, когда значение сигналаХстановится равным наименьшему значению сигнала Х, в счетчике 3образуется число нульПри этом дешифратор 6 с помощью элемента НЕ 17и элемента И 15 блокирует вход вычитания счетчика 3, благодаря чемупри дальнейшем отрицательном изменении сигнала Х(С) число нуль в немсохраняется, и одновременно открываетэлемент И 16 В результате каждыйпоследующий кодовый импульс К , проходя через открытый элемент И 16 науправляющий вход регистра 10, осуществляет запись в регистр 10 информации из реверсивного счетчика 5,Отсюда следует, что к моменту времени , , когда происходит очередное1 физменение аналогового сигнала Х(С),в регистре 10 содержится код величиныХ представляющий собой новое наименьшее значение сигнала от моментаначала цикла его обработки,Начиная с момента времени когда образуются кодовые импульсы К ,счетчик 3 работает на сложение, асчетчик 4 - на вычитание, причем содержимое счетчика 3 пропорциональноположительному приращению сигналаХ(С) относительно наименьшего значения Х , а содержимое счетчика11 ф4 пропорционально отрицательномуприращению сигнала Х(Т) относительнонаибольшего значения Х 1,В момент времени Т, (фиг,2),когдасигнал Х(С) принимает значение Х,равное наибольшему значению Х, содержимое счетчика 4 становится равным нулю, Это вызывает срабатываниедешифратора 7, который блокируетдальнейший счет на вычитание в счетчике 4 и одновременно открывает элемент И 14В результате кодовые импульсы, поступая на управляющий входрегистра 9, осуществляют запись информации из реверсивного счетчика 5в регистр 9, Поэтому к моменту времени С окончания цикла обработкисигнала в регистре 9 содержится кодвеличины Х которая представляетсобой (фиг,2) наибольшее значение сигнала Х(г) в течение цикла его обработки, а в регистре 10 содержитсякод величины Х 1 представляющий со-.бой наименьшее значение сигнала Хв течение цикла обработки, (интервалавремени между контактами С,и Г) .Формула ИзобретенияУстройство для цифровой обработки аналогового сигнапа, содержащее схе15 б му сравнения, генератор импульсов,первый - шестой элементы И, первый ивторой элементы НЕ, первый - третийреверсивные счетчики, первый и второй дешифраторы и цифроаналоговыйпреобразователь, вход которого соединен с выходом первого счетчика, авыход - с первым входом схемы сравнения, второй вход которой являетсявходом устройства, а первый и второй выходы подключены к первым входам одноименных элементов И, вторыевходы которых соединены с выходомгенератора импульсов, выход первого.элемента И подключен к входам суммирования первого и второго реверсивных счетчиков, выход второго элемента И подключен к входу вычитания первого и входу суммирования второгореверсивных счетчиков, выход третьегоэлемента И соединен с входом вычитания второго реверсивного счетчика,выход которого подключен к входу первого дешифратора, выход которого соединен с входом первого элемента НЕ ипервым входом пятого элемента.И, выход третьего реверсивного счетчикаподключен к входу второго дешифратора, выход которого соединен с входом б 370 Овторого элемента НЕ и первым входом.шестого элемента И, о т л и ч а ющ е е с я тем,что, с целью расширения функциональных возможностей устройства за счет определения наибольщего и наименьшего значений сигнала,в него введены первый и второй регистры, выход первого элемента НЕподключен к первому входу третьегоэлемента И, второй вход которого соединен с выходом второго элемента Ии вторым входом пятого элемента И,выход которого подключен к входу уп 15 равления записью первого регистра,выход второго элемента НЕ соединен спервым входом четвертого элемента И,выход которого подключен к входу вычитания третьего реверсивного счет 20 чика, а второй вход - к выходу первого элемента И и второму входу шестогоэлемента И, выход котоРого соединенс входом управления записью второгорегистра, информационный вход которо 25 го обьединен с информационным входомпервого регистра и подключен к выходу первого реверсивного счетчика, выходы первого и второго регистровявляются одноименными информационнымивыходами устройства,

Смотреть

Заявка

4483266, 25.07.1988

ИНСТИТУТ КИБЕРНЕТИКИ ИМ. В. М. ГЛУШКОВА

ФАЙНЗИЛЬБЕРГ ЛЕОНИД СОЛОМОНОВИЧ

МПК / Метки

МПК: G01R 19/25

Метки: сигнала, аналогового, цифровой

Опубликовано: 23.05.1990

Код ссылки

<a href="http://patents.su/5-1566370-ustrojjstvo-dlya-cifrovojj-obrabotki-analogovogo-signala.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для цифровой обработки аналогового сигнала</a>

Похожие патенты